Hi Clint, You said "easiest" so I thought I'd chime in with the suggestion to spend the $40 and get a pressure bleeder. Other folks on this list turned me on to this method and, man, is it easy - fill it up with new fluid, hook it up to your reservoir behind the dash, pump it to something like 10-12 psi, open up your slave bleeder valve with a length of tubing on it leading to a jug/jar...drink a beer...you're done.
